技术文摘
Vue ElementUI Table 编辑表单弹框中编辑明细数据的实现
Vue ElementUI Table 编辑表单弹框中编辑明细数据的实现
在 Vue 开发中,结合 ElementUI 的 Table 组件来实现编辑表单弹框中的明细数据编辑是一项常见且实用的功能。它能够为用户提供直观、便捷的操作体验,提升应用的交互性和实用性。
首先,我们需要搭建好 Vue 项目的基本框架,并引入 ElementUI 库。在页面中创建一个 Table 表格来展示数据。为了实现编辑功能,通常会为每一行数据添加一个编辑按钮。
当用户点击编辑按钮时,触发一个事件,弹出编辑表单弹框。在弹框中,根据当前行的数据进行表单字段的初始化填充。这可以通过获取对应行的数据,并将其赋值给表单组件的绑定值来实现。
在表单中,使用 ElementUI 提供的各种输入组件,如输入框、下拉选择框等,来满足不同类型数据的编辑需求。同时,为表单添加确认和取消按钮。
确认按钮的点击事件中,需要对用户输入的数据进行合法性校验。如果数据合法,将编辑后的数据更新到原始数据数组中,并关闭弹框,刷新 Table 表格以显示更新后的结果。
为了确保良好的用户体验,在编辑过程中,要实时显示数据输入的错误提示,帮助用户及时纠正错误。
在实现这一功能时,还需要考虑数据的异步加载和更新情况,确保在网络请求过程中的数据一致性和稳定性。
总之,通过合理运用 Vue 和 ElementUI 的特性,我们能够轻松实现 Table 编辑表单弹框中明细数据的编辑功能,为用户提供高效、便捷的数据操作方式,增强应用的实用性和竞争力。
TAGS: Vue ElementUI Table 编辑 Vue 表单编辑 ElementUI 编辑功能 编辑明细数据实现
- 超级加倍:互联网大厂容灾架构的设计与落地策略(跨机房、同城双活、异地多活)
- 深入解析垃圾收集算法的实现细节
- POST 请求发送两次的技术深度剖析
- Vue.js 开发效率飙升 700%!2024 年 10 大最火 UI 库揭秘
- 线程池的相关问题:定义、与连接池的区别及工作原理
- Vue3 项目中轻松实现主题切换
- Git 拉取项目报错“filename to long”的解决办法
- 想看源码却不知如何入手怎么办?
- OpenResty 实战系列:执行流程及阶段深度解析
- VueConf 2024 结束,7 大模块剖析 Vue 未来生态演变!
- 大厂揭秘:SpringBoot 项目舍 Tomcat 选 Undertow 的缘由
- Python 报表生成的卓越工具:Excel 与 Word 篇
- B+树层面数据查询的全程解析
- React 新 Hook - UseFormStatus 详细使用指南
- Pulsar 分布式系统中负载均衡技术的全面解析与优秀实践